No female soldier was involved in the 1982 coup, says retired soldier

Esther Jombo recalls how in her own small ways and capacity, and working from behind the scenes, helped Kenya Army crush the 1982 coup.

The (Rtd) Lt-Col was a commanding officer of a nondescript but important unit when the abortive coup was staged in the wee hours of the night by a section of reneged Kenya Air Force (KAF) soldiers.
